Why work here? Our active approach provides a new passion for marketing and events that create strong brand relationships with our target audience.
We are looking for a marketing and sales associate with a strong desire to develop communication skills to work in a busy marketing company based in Glasgow. A successful applicant will be able to work as part of a growing, friendly team. Experience with roles interacting with clients is an advantage, but not mandatory.
You will work in an extremely dynamic team being trained in sales development and on-ground marketing skills.
Role: Well spoken, passionate person as a face of our clients. You will be taught to provide a full range of customer support services, including pricing information, lead time requests and active sales management. Establishing and maintaining effective relationships with specific managers and end users. Participation in advertising and active advertising campaigns will also be part of the role of the Entry Level Sales Specialist.
Main responsibilities of The Entry Level Specialist:
- Help set up and present client services to potential customers.
- Providing excellent customer service.
- Responding to customer inquiries and questions.
- Complete sales reports and daily progress tracking.
- Analyse market trends, and keep track of results.
- Implement Marketing tactics.
- Generate Leads.
- Customer Acquisitions.
Successful candidates will have the following attributes:
- Great communication skills.
- Outgoing and people oriented.
- Great organisational skills.
- Be prepared to take responsibility.
- Thrive working alone and in a team.
- Hardworking and a problem solver.
- You must be passionate, motivated and willing to learn.
Previous experience is not necessary, full paid training will be provided. Experience in office/retail/sales will be useful. How to prepare for a job interview at WAVE Experience
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and the company’s approach to marketing and events. Familiarise yourself with their recent campaigns and how they engage with their target audience. This will show your genuine interest and help you stand out.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since this role requires great communication skills,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. You might want to prepare a few examples of how you've successfully interacted with clients or worked in a team. This will demonstrate your ability to connect with others.
✨Be Ready to Learn
The company values motivation and a willingness to learn. Be prepared to discuss how you’ve approached learning new skills in the past. Highlight your enthusiasm for training and development, as this aligns perfectly with what they’re looking for.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, training processes, or upcoming marketing campaigns. This shows that you’re engaged and genuinely interested in the role and the company.
